The painting represents one of the seven landscapes that Camille Pissarro (1830-1903) painted during his stay in Berneval, a small town near Dieppe, during the summer of 1900. The work was created in the last decade of the artist's life, which he spent in intensive work and frequent travels. "Landscape in Berneval" belongs to the type of Pissarro's rural landscapes where vegetation and sky occupy the focus of the painter's interest. The painting presents an impressionistic process in the treatment of light which tends to capture the dynamic aspects of nature, while the short and energetic strokes he uses to paint the grass and the canopy imply an echo of his divisional phase.
